Rather than selling a small amount of ready-to-use curry by the jar, Woodland Foods is introducing a new range of dry curry starters at the Winter Fancy Food Show that only need the addition of water.
The just-add-water sauces are made with a base of sweet coconut milk powder and other traditional ingredients to make varieties such as: Goan Coconut Curry, Indonesian Rendang, Jamaican Coconut Curry, Thai Coconut Green Curry and Thai Coconut Red Curry. Some of the fragrant ingredients that can be found in the range include: lemongrass, green chiles, ginger and lime leaves.
As many consumers are now looking for globally inspired products to enhance their at-home meals, products like these curry starters are being favored for their authentic ingredient and ability to be quickly prepared.
